Zelensky enacts law on state budget for 2020

The Verkhovna Rada passed at second reading and as a whole the bill on the state budget of Ukraine for 2020 on November 14.

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ky has enacted the law on the state budget of Ukraine for 2020.

As of December 11, the law was returned to parliament with the president's signature, as evidenced by information published on the official website of the Verkhovna Rada, Ukraine's parliament.

As UNIAN reported earlier, on October 18, the Verkhovna Rada adopted in its first reading the government bill on the state budget for 2020 with revenues in the amount of UAH 1.079 trillion, expenses at UAH 1.170 trillion, and deficit ceiling at UAH 95 billion, or 2.1% of GDP.

On November 5, the Cabinet of Ministers submitted to the parliament a draft state budget for 2020, finalized for second reading, based on an updated forecast with a GDP growth of 3.7% and an average annual rate of UAH 27/USD.

On November 14, the Verkhovna Rada passed the budget at second reading and as a whole.
